Output 72e8ad0b43a0e58ddd42d5900f47832176b19c11bbc7faa2b6f4bbcc3c61ffc1: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f968abd288ac758e1fba3a6e3e8ab3b8400919 OP_EQUAL
address
ABDMxwtbw77jGnZRfLsQXxzb4mToKG8T2U
transaction
72e8ad0b43a0e58ddd42d5900f47832176b19c11bbc7faa2b6f4bbcc3c61ffc1